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Bushy-tailed Mongoose | Minute pirate bug |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Arthropoda (Arthropods)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Insecta (Insects) |
| Order | Carnivora (Carnivorans) | Hemiptera (Hemiptera) |
| Family | Herpestidae | Anthocoridae |
| Genus | Bdeogale | Anthocoris |
| Species | Bdeogale crassicauda | Anthocoris nemorum |
